  1. A male given name from Scottish Gaelic.

词源

From Scottish Gaelic Alasdair, from Norman Alexandre or Latin Alexander, from Ancient Greek Ἀλέξανδρος (Aléxandros), from ἀλέξω (aléxō, “to defend”) + ἀνδρ- (andr-), the stem of ἀνήρ (anḗr, “man”).
